How to Choose the Right Premium Vodka for You

Before diving into specific bottles, a few key points can help you make a more informed decision. Understanding these factors will allow you to select a vodka that suits your taste and intended use, especially when making vodka for cocktails.

1. Consider the Base Ingredients

The raw material used to create vodka has a significant impact on its final taste and texture. Most vodkas are distilled from grains like wheat, rye or corn.

  • Wheat-based vodkas, such as Absolut vodka, are often characterised by a smooth, clean and slightly sweet profile.
  • Rye-based vodkas can have a hint of spice and a more robust character.
  • Corn-based vodkas tend to be neutral and mild. For a classic smooth vodka experience, a high-quality grain-based option is a reliable starting point.

2. Note the Distillation and Filtration Process

The terms "triple distilled" or "charcoal filtered" are not just marketing jargon. Multiple distillations and filtrations are processes used to remove impurities from the spirit. This generally results in a purer, cleaner taste with less of the harsh alcoholic burn that can be present in lower-quality spirits. Brands like Smirnoff vodka place a strong emphasis on their filtration methods to achieve a consistent and smooth finish.

3. Choose the Right Size for Your Needs

Vodka is commonly available in a few standard sizes. A vodka 70cl bottle is the typical format in the UK and is ideal for stocking a home bar or trying a new brand without a large commitment. For those who entertain frequently or have found a favourite spirit, a 1 litre vodka bottle often provides better value and ensures you have enough on hand for gatherings.

Frequently Asked Questions About Premium Vodka

What makes a vodka 'premium'? The term 'premium' generally refers to a combination of factors, including the quality of the base ingredients (such as specific grains or potatoes), the meticulousness of the production process (like the number of distillations and filtrations) and the resulting smoothness and purity of the final spirit. A premium vodka typically has a cleaner taste with less harshness compared to standard options.

What is a good vodka for a Moscow Mule? For a Moscow Mule, you want a vodka that is clean and smooth but has enough character to stand up to the bold flavours of ginger beer and lime. A high-quality, grain-based vodka is an excellent choice, as its neutral-to-subtly-flavoured profile will complement the other ingredients without getting lost. Should I keep vodka in the freezer? Storing vodka in the freezer is a popular practice, though not essential. Chilling the spirit to a very low temperature can enhance its viscosity (making it feel thicker and more velvety) and mute some of the alcohol's intensity, which many find creates a smoother sipping experience. For mixing in cocktails, however, room-temperature vodka is perfectly acceptable.
